Protocol summary

Study aim
Comparative study of the results of Simple and Modified PAIR methods in the treatment of liver hydatid cyst
Design
This is a non-blinded randomized clinical trial with a parallel design. This randomized study will be conducted on 24 patients with hepatic hydatid cysts. A simple randomization method will be used for randomization, and participants will be assigned to two intervention groups.
Settings and conduct
This study, which will be conducted at Imam Reza Hospital in Kermanshah, is not blinded. Before the intervention begins, the size and volume of the cyst, as well as the presence of a fluid component in the cavity, irregularity, and thickening of the cyst wall, will be carefully examined and recorded in a checklist for each patient.
Participants/Inclusion and excl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: Informed consent; Individuals diagnosed with hepatic hydatid cysts. Exclusion criteria: Patients concurrently infected with pulmonary hydatid cysts;
Intervention groups
In the Simple PAIR method, an 18-gauge Shiba needle is inserted into the cyst under ultrasound guidance, and a portion of the cyst contents is evacuated with volume control and then aspirated. The entire cyst contents are aspirated and the cyst is filled with a mixture of nonionic contrast medium and saline solution (½ contrast medium + ½ saline solution 0.09% [NaCl]) equal to the aspirated amount. The contents of the cyst cavity are aspirated again after the cystogram, and then absolute alcohol (97% ethyl alcohol from Merck) is injected in a volume equivalent to 30% of the aspirate. In the Modified PAIR method, the cyst is punctured with an 18-gauge Shiba needle and a hydrophilic wire is inserted into it. Then, the dissecting route is inserted and fixed inside the cyst with a thin 6f dilator and the thinnest available 8f catheter using the Seldinger method.
